1. Edible value of sugarcane

According to analysis, sugarcane juice accounts for about 70%, of which the sugar content can reach 17%, so it is known as a "sugar water warehouse". Most of the sugar it contains is sucrose, followed by glucose and fructose. In addition to sugar, it also contains protein, fat, carbohydrates, minerals such as calcium, phosphorus, iron and various vitamins. It also contains a variety of amino acids, organic acids, etc., as many as 30 kinds. In addition to giving people a sweet enjoyment, these substances can also increase human energy and calories. Recent studies have found that the polysaccharides in sugarcane bagasse can also inhibit cancer cells and sarcomas.

3. Moldy sugarcane is poisonous and cannot be eaten

Moldy sugarcane is usually more toxic, mainly due to aflatoxin produced by Aspergillus flavus and Aspergillus parasiticus. Moreover, poisoning can easily cause central nervous system damage in patients. Generally speaking, vomiting, dizziness, headache, visual impairment, and limb stiffness appear 2-8 hours after eating sugarcane. These are obvious symptoms of sugarcane poisoning, and severe cases can lead to coma and death.
